Re: Any new Mohegan Sun rumors?
[ QUOTE ]
No poker room in the near future. Manager was recently quoted saying he didn't think the area could support 2 rooms. [/ QUOTE ] Not entirely correct. I used to work there. The statement you gave is a bit missleading. The actual quote said something to the affect of "at the time we closed our poker room, we felt that New England couldn't support 2 poker rooms.". Which, at this time was true. Foxwoods would barely get 15 games going, Mohegan 10 or so on anything but a weekend. Mind you, this was before the WPT hit on TV in 2002. The rest is history. I have friends in management there and the news is the same, nothing in the near future. But if you know casinos, they dont let any info out till the last minute. |

Re: Any new Mohegan Sun rumors?
Just so we get the timeline right, Travel Channel started broadcasting the WPT on March 30th, 2003 and Mohegan Sun closed the poker room on September 2nd, 2003.
